Elden Ring: Nightreign will eliminate the in-game messaging feature previously seen in other FromSoftware titles. Project director Junya Ishizaki explained this decision in a recent interview, citing the game's shorter play sessions. Nightreign's approximately forty-minute gameplay sessions leave insufficient time for players to leave or read messages.

"Given sessions are roughly forty minutes long, there's not enough time to send or read messages, so we removed the feature," Ishizaki stated.

This choice is noteworthy given the importance of player messaging in past FromSoftware games, which enhanced player interaction and enjoyment. However, the development team deemed the feature unsuitable for Nightreign's design.

Nightreign is a standalone experience, separate from the Elden Ring storyline, to preserve the original game's integrity. It promises a fresh adventure with unique challenges and encounters, while retaining the signature atmosphere and complexity of the Elden Ring world.
